Latest Patents

Doris holds a patent for "Biological surfaces," which describes a base body containing a substrate partially coated with a carbon-containing layer. This unique layer is functionalized with a molecule attached directly or through one or more linker or functional groups. The resulting functionalized carbon-containing surface is designed to influence biological processes, showcasing Doris’s ability to merge materials science with biology effectively.
